Information: 

A detailed exposition of the principles involved in designing analog circuits in MOS LSI. Device physics, small signal and large signal models, biasing, basic circuit building blocks, operational amplifier design, large signal considerations and principles of switched capacitor networks. Applications: fully integrated filters, comparators, A/D and D/A converters, and other signal processing circuits. A comprehensive design project is a required part of the subject. 4 Engineering Design Points.
